The plant hormone used to destroy weeds in a field is:
2, 4-D
IBA
IAA
NAA
2, 4-D (2, 4-dichlorophenoxyacetic acid) is a synthetic auxin widely used as a herbicide to kill dicotyledonous weeds. It does not affect mature monocotyledonous plants and is used to prepare weed-free lawns . IAA (Indole-3-acetic acid) and IBA (Indole butyric acid) are natural auxins, while NAA (Naphthalene acetic acid) is another synthetic auxin generally used for rooting or preventing fruit drop, but 2, 4-D is the specific example given for destroying weeds.
